Ellis Returns To K-Wings

Published on November 12, 2009 under ECHL (ECHL)
Kalamazoo Wings News Release


Kalamazoo , MI- The Kalamazoo Wings, proud member of the ECHL and affiliate of the Philadelphia Flyers and San Jose Sharks of the National Hockey League, announce goaltender Julien Ellis has been returned from loan from the Lake Erie Monsters of the American Hockey League.

Ellis, who is 2-1-0-0 on the season, was in uniform yesterday afternoon for the Monsters as they battled the Grand Rapids Griffins at Van Andel Arena.

A former draft pick of the Vancouver Canucks, Ellis is one of six players this season that has dressed for an AHL club.
